--- title: Cluster sizing weight: 60 aliases: /multicloud-gitops-amx/mcg-amx-cluster-sizing/ --- include::modules/comm-attributes.adoc[] :toc: :imagesdir: /images :_content-type: ASSEMBLY [id="about-openshift-cluster-sizing-mcg"] == About OpenShift cluster sizing for the {amx-mcg-pattern} The minimum requirements for an {ocp} cluster depend on your installation platform, for example: * For AWS, see link:https://docs.openshift.com/container-platform/4.16/installing/installing_aws/preparing-to-install-on-aws.html#requirements-for-installing-ocp-on-aws[Installing {ocp} on AWS]. * For bare-metal, see link:https://docs.openshift.com/container-platform/4.16/installing/installing_bare_metal/installing-bare-metal.html#installation-minimum-resource-requirements_installing-bare-metal[Installing {ocp} on bare metal]. To understand cluster sizing requirements for the {amx-rhoai-mcg-pattern}, consider the following components that the pattern deploys on the datacenter or the hub OpenShift cluster: |=== | Name | Kind | Namespace | Description | multicloud-gitops-amx-rhoai-hub | Application | multicloud-gitops-amx-rhoai-hub | Hub GitOps management | Red Hat Advanced Cluster Management | Operator | open-cluster-management | Advance Cluster Management | Red Hat OpenShift GitOps | Operator | openshift-operators | OpenShift GitOps | Node Feature Discovery | Operator | openshift-nfd | Manages the detection and labeling of hardware features and configuration (for example {intel-amx}) | Red Hat OpenShift Data Foundation | Operator | openshift-storage | Cloud Native storage solution |=== The {amx-rhoai-mcg-pattern} also includes the Red Hat Advanced Cluster Management (RHACM) supporting operator that is installed by OpenShift GitOps using Argo CD. [id="mcg-openshift-datacenter-hub-cluster-size"] == {amx-rhoai-mcg-pattern} with OpenShift clusters sizes The datacenter hub OpenShift cluster needs to be a bit bigger than the Factory/Edge clusters because this is where the developers will be running pipelines to build and deploy the {amx-rhoai-mcg-pattern} on the cluster. The above cluster sizing is close to a minimum size for a Datacenter HUB cluster. In the next few sections we take some snapshots of the cluster utilization while the {amx-rhoai-mcg-pattern} is running. Keep in mind that resources will have to be added as more developers are working building their applications. The recommended clusters sizes for datacenter hub and for managed datacenter are the same in this case: include::modules/intel-recommended-cluster-sizing-5th-gen-amx.adoc[]